Understanding Your Individual Protein Needs
While a 70 kg person has a baseline protein requirement, the specific amount you need can fluctuate. The standard recommendation of 0.8g per kg is only the bare minimum for sedentary individuals to prevent deficiency. For those who are more active, pursuing specific fitness goals, or managing their weight, this number is a starting point, not the destination. Optimal protein intake supports muscle repair, satiety, and metabolism, so calculating your personalized amount is crucial for achieving your health objectives.
The Calculation: Protein Intake Based on Activity Level
To determine your ideal protein target, first, identify your activity level. Below are the common guidelines used by nutrition and fitness experts to help a 70 kg individual calculate their daily protein needs.
- Sedentary Adults (little to no exercise): Multiply your body weight by 0.8 to 1.0 grams. For a 70kg individual, this is 56-70 grams per day.
- Moderately Active Adults (exercise 2-3 times per week): Aim for 1.0 to 1.2 grams per kilogram. This translates to 70-84 grams of protein daily.
- Active Individuals (exercise 3-5 times per week): Increase your intake to 1.2 to 1.6 grams per kilogram. A 70kg person would target 84-112 grams daily.
- Strength Training Athletes (building muscle mass): Multiply by 1.6 to 2.2 grams per kilogram. This range is 112-154 grams per day for a 70kg person.
- Endurance Athletes (runners, cyclists): The recommendation is typically 1.2 to 1.6 grams per kilogram, placing the target at 84-112 grams daily.
- Weight Loss (while preserving muscle): A higher intake of 1.6 to 2.4 grams per kilogram is often recommended to promote satiety and protect lean mass during a calorie deficit. This puts the target at 112-168 grams for a 70kg individual.
High-Quality Protein Sources: Animal vs. Plant-Based
Protein can be obtained from both animal and plant-based foods. While animal proteins are often considered 'complete' because they contain all essential amino acids, a varied plant-based diet can also provide a full amino acid profile.
| Source Category | Pros | Cons | Examples for 70kg Diet | 
|---|---|---|---|
| Animal-Based | Complete amino acid profile, high bioavailability, rich in nutrients like iron and B12. | Can be higher in saturated fat depending on cut, potential ethical or environmental concerns. | Chicken breast, salmon, eggs, Greek yogurt, lean beef, shrimp. | 
| Plant-Based | Generally lower in calories and fat, higher in fiber, beneficial for heart health. | May lack one or more essential amino acids, requiring combinations for completeness. | Lentils, chickpeas, tofu, quinoa, edamame, nuts, seeds, beans. | 
Timing and Distribution: Optimizing Your Intake
While total daily intake is the most important factor, distributing your protein throughout the day can optimize muscle protein synthesis and manage appetite.
- Spread it out: Instead of consuming a massive amount in one meal, aim for 20-40 grams of protein per meal, spread across 3-5 meals and snacks.
- Post-Workout: While the anabolic window is not as tight as once believed, consuming protein within a couple of hours after resistance training can support muscle repair.
- Snacks: High-protein snacks can help curb hunger and reduce cravings throughout the day, which is especially helpful for weight management.
Vegetarian/Vegan Considerations for a 70kg Person
For those following a plant-based diet, meeting your protein needs at 70kg is entirely achievable. The key is variety. Combining different plant proteins throughout the day—for example, pairing legumes with grains—ensures you get all the essential amino acids. Soy products like tofu and edamame, as well as quinoa, are considered complete proteins and are excellent choices.

Dangers of Excessive Protein Intake
While adequate protein is vital, consuming excessive amounts is not beneficial and can pose health risks. For healthy individuals, the kidneys can handle a high protein load, but it can cause issues for those with pre-existing kidney conditions. The body will convert surplus protein into glucose or fat, meaning it offers diminishing returns for muscle gain beyond a certain point and can contribute to weight gain if total calories are too high. A balanced diet that includes all macronutrients remains the healthiest approach.
The Role of Protein in Aging
As we age, our bodies become less efficient at processing protein, and muscle loss (sarcopenia) can accelerate. Therefore, older adults may need a slightly higher protein intake—closer to 1.2 to 1.5 grams per kilogram—to maintain muscle mass and strength. Combining higher protein consumption with resistance training is a highly effective strategy to combat age-related muscle deterioration and improve overall mobility.
Common Protein Intake Mistakes
- Ignoring total calorie intake: Focusing solely on protein while ignoring total calories can lead to unwanted weight gain if you consume a surplus. All macronutrients matter.
- Relying too heavily on supplements: While convenient, supplements should complement, not replace, whole food protein sources which provide additional nutrients like fiber and minerals.
- Not distributing protein: Trying to hit a high protein target in one or two large meals is less effective for muscle synthesis than spreading it evenly throughout the day.
- Overestimating needs: More isn't always better. Consuming protein far beyond your needs based on activity and goals simply provides excess calories.
